Woman faints and found in grassy area near Blue Water Bridge, St Clair County MI


A 50-year-old woman fainted and was found lying in a grassy area near the south turnout by Blue Water Bridge, across from the casino sign. She was initially unresponsive but began to regain consciousness before emergency responders arrived. She may have fallen off her bike.
